- Manoj A nAug 09, 2022 · 4 years agoGwei, short for gigawei, is a commonly used unit for measuring transaction fees in the Ethereum network. One of the advantages of using gwei as a transaction fee is its compatibility with the Ethereum ecosystem. Since gwei is the native unit of measurement for fees in Ethereum, it aligns perfectly with the network's fee structure and ensures smooth and efficient fee calculations. Moreover, gwei allows for granular fee adjustments, enabling users to set fees at the desired level of priority. This flexibility is particularly useful during periods of high network congestion when users may want to prioritize their transactions by setting higher fees.
